OEM Press Systems is currently developing a premier press line with next-generation electrical controls and HMI interface. The company's computer control interface, "Advatage" will soon be release on a vacuum press system.

The "OEM Advantage – Next Generation" HMI is designed with a new touchscreen interface that features enhanced recipe screens and recipe manager, enhanced data collection. Engineers will now be able to determine what data should be collected and saved during a cycle, and improve operator alarm, warning and status messaging to users via a message center.

Additional, optional features include interfacing to a SQL database, or MS Access or Excel, and ERP/MES systems, pulling recipes from a client server based on barcode scanner input and accessing real-time information on alarms, process values and other events via e-mail to desktop computers, email-enabled phone or other enabled devices.

"All of the new features and capabilities are designed with the process engineer in mind, we want to facilitate the collection of valuable pertinent data that helps the engineer do his job," said Dale Davis, director of operations for OEM Press Systems.
